Leeds Rail Station - new southern entrance

Metro is currently working closely with Network Rail, local train operators and Leeds City Council on proposals for a new southern entrance to Leeds rail station.

The new entrance would significantly improve pedestrian journey times for station users who currently live or work in, or travel to, the regeneration areas in the south of the city centre such as the Holbeck Village development.

Network Rail are currently working on the development of options for this long-needed scheme with a view to agreeing a single option during the early part of 2008.

The proposals have been identified in Network Rail’s Strategic Business Plan for 2009 - 2014 with a proposed implementation date of 2010/11.
